Talent Analysis

 

Bennett is an offensively creative winger who is most effective when the puck is on his stick. He has the ability to carry the puck up ice, run the powerplay from the half-boards, play the point, and possesses a hard and accurate repertoire of shots. He is also quite adept at creating open ice.

 

"[bennett] is a guy who you maybe look to get opportunities to see what he can do in offensive roles," Penguins head coach Dan Bylsma said of the winger. "Not necessarily a guy who's going to race up and down the ice with his speed, but just his hands, his ability to create space, (and) ability to get his shot off is fairly evident in seeing him. You envision that in him as a pro player."

 

Top 6 forward on the Penguins, soon.
